FEIN

Many basic operations for business owners require a federal employer identification number or FEIN. This number is unique to each business and can be used to file business taxes and avoid tax penalties, open a business bank account, establish credit for your business, and prevent identity theft, among other purposes. FEIN numbers are free to obtain from the IRS.

SAM

SAM stands for the Systems for Award Management. Businesses can obtain a SAM number free of charge from the General Services Administration, however, the usual waiting period after filing your application can take several weeks. Businesses wishing to apply for federal grants, contracts, and most purchasing agreements must have a SAM number.

DBE

Disadvantaged Business Enterprise Program (BEP/VBP) are administered by the State of Illinois through the Department of Transportation, or IDOT. It is free of charge to register in the program, but is limited to businesses owned by minorities, women, persons with disabilities, and veterans of the armed services. IDOT offers complimentary DBE Supportive Services certification consultants to assist you with completion of your application. Business certified as a DBE can apply for recognition certification with other agencies, including CMS BEP Certification.
